Job Description

Line of Business: VDI and Mobility

Duration: 8 months (Possibility of Extension)

Location: Downtown Toronto or Scarborough - Hybrid - 2-3 days onsite

Must Have Requirements:

  • 3+ years Ansible (roles, collections, Molecule, CI/CD).
  • Strong Linux (RHEL), networking, TLS/PKI, and load balancing fundamentals.
  • JVM operation basics (heap/GC) and Java web app deployment experience.
  • Responsibilities:

    • Design reverse proxy and app tier topologies:

  • Active/active Tomcat clusters with load balancing & health checks (at Apache layer or external LB).
  • Session management strategy: sticky sessions via cookie, or session replication/Redis-backed sessions when stickiness is not possible.
  • • Performance engineering:

  • Tomcat connector threads, acceptCount, connectionTimeout, JVM sizing (Xms/Xmx), GC tuning (G1/Parallel), and thread pools.
  • • High availability & scaling:

  • Multi-AZ/region design, zero...
  • Ready to Apply?

    Take the next step in your AI career. Submit your application to S.i. Systems today.

    Submit Application